Comment utiliser la commande Ping pour résoudre les problèmes de réseau

La commande ping est l'un des outils de diagnostic réseau les plus utiles à votre disposition. (network diagnostic)Il est utile pour trouver des problèmes à la fois sur votre réseau local et sur Internet au sens large. Regardons ce que fait la commande ping et comment l'utiliser.

Qu'est-ce que cela signifie(Mean) de faire un ping sur quelque chose ?

"Pinger" quelque chose sur un réseau signifie que vous envoyez un paquet Internet à un ordinateur de destination ou à un autre périphérique réseau, en demandant une réponse. Cet appareil vous renvoie ensuite un paquet. 

Lorsque le paquet revient (s'il revient, c'est-à-dire), vous pouvez apprendre toutes sortes de choses intéressantes sur le réseau entre vous et la destination. 

Le plus souvent, nous voulons simplement savoir combien de temps prend la réponse. Ainsi, lorsque quelqu'un mentionne le "ping" d'un site Web (par exemple), il est généralement exprimé en millisecondes, un nombre inférieur étant généralement meilleur.

Qu'est-ce qu'un paquet Internet ?

Pour mieux comprendre le ping, vous devez en savoir un peu plus sur le paquet que vous envoyez à l'ordinateur cible ou au périphérique réseau sous forme de « ping ». 

Les paquets sont les unités fondamentales de l' Internet moderne(modern internet) . Lorsque vous envoyez des données à quelqu'un, comme une photo, elles sont divisées en petits morceaux. Chaque paquet est marqué d'une adresse source et de destination, puis envoyé sur Internet. Ces paquets transitent par de nombreux autres ordinateurs, tels que des serveurs Web et des routeurs Internet. Les paquets continuent d'être transmis jusqu'à ce qu'ils atteignent le système cible.

Ce que vous pouvez utiliser pour Ping

La commande ping a deux utilisations principales :

  • Pour vérifier si votre connexion à un ordinateur distant fonctionne.
  • Pour vérifier la santé de cette connexion.

Même si votre ping atteint sa destination et que vous obtenez une réponse, la réponse ping vous indiquera combien de temps un paquet a mis pour revenir et combien de paquets ont été perdus. Vous pouvez utiliser la commande ping pour diagnostiquer si la connexion est trop lente ou peu fiable.

Quelles sortes de choses pouvez-vous cingler ? 

  • En théorie, vous pouvez pinguer n'importe quoi avec une adresse IP(IP address)
  • Vous pouvez envoyer un ping aux périphériques de votre réseau local pour vous assurer qu'ils sont correctement connectés. 
  • Vous pouvez également cingler des sites Web pour voir si vous pouvez les atteindre.

Comment utiliser Ping sous Windows

L'utilisation du ping est simple. Vous l'exécutez à partir de l' invite de commande(Command Prompt) ou de PowerShell , mais nous utilisons l' invite de commande(Command Prompt) dans cet exemple :

  1. Ouvrez le menu Démarrer(Start Menu) , recherchez l' invite de commande(Command Prompt) et sélectionnez-la.

  1. Tapez Ping , puis entrez soit l' adresse IP(IP address) de l'appareil, soit l' URL d'un site(URL of a site) auquel vous souhaitez envoyer un ping.

Nous avons utilisé Google.com comme exemple ci-dessous.

Une fois lancé, le ping enverra quatre paquets de données.

Un message pour n'importe quel paquet qui dit "demande expirée" implique que votre ordinateur n'a pas reçu de réponse de la cible. Si certains paquets sont perdus, certains des chemins de routage entre votre ordinateur et la cible ont un problème.

Modificateurs de commande Ping(Ping Command Modifiers) utiles pour Windows

Il existe de nombreux commutateurs de commande que vous pouvez utiliser avec la commande ping. Les commutateurs sont des options supplémentaires pour personnaliser le fonctionnement de la commande ping. Si vous voulez voir une liste complète des options, tout ce que vous avez à faire est de taper ping /help à l'invite de commande et d'appuyer sur Entrée(Enter) . Vous verrez toute la liste ainsi que la syntaxe et l'utilisation.

Vous trouverez ci(Below) -dessous une liste de quelques commutateurs de commande utiles à la plupart des utilisateurs :

  • /t : Envoyez un ping continu à une cible aussi longtemps que vous le souhaitez. Appuyez sur Ctrl + Break pour interrompre le processus et consulter les statistiques actuelles. Pour quitter, appuyez sur Ctrl + C.
  • /a : résout le nom d'hôte d'une adresse IP. Ceci est utile si vous avez une adresse IP et que vous souhaitez connaître l'adresse Web associée au serveur spécifique auquel vous envoyez un ping.
  • /n X : Remplacez « X » par le nombre de pings que vous souhaitez envoyer. La valeur par défaut est quatre. Mais si vous souhaitez mieux analyser le nombre de paquets perdus, envoyez plus de pings pour avoir une idée plus précise du nombre de paquets perdus en moyenne.
  • /w X : Remplacez "X" par le nombre de millisecondes que vous souhaitez attendre avant de déclarer un délai d'attente. Par défaut, cette valeur est de 4000 ms. Si vous pensez qu'une connexion peut fonctionner mais que le ping n'attend pas assez longtemps pour une réponse, vous pouvez augmenter X pour voir si vous avez raison.
  • /l X : Remplacez « X » par une valeur en octets pour augmenter la taille de chaque ping. Par défaut, cette valeur est 32, mais vous pouvez l'augmenter à 65527. Ceci est utile pour voir si ce sont les tailles de paquets qui causent des problèmes sur votre réseau. Un ping de 32 octets fonctionnerait avec le paramètre par défaut, mais quelque chose de plus grand entraînerait la perte de paquets.

Comment utiliser Ping sur macOS

Pour les utilisateurs Mac , vous devez utiliser Terminal . Les versions précédentes de macOS incluaient Network Utility , qui était un utilitaire graphique que vous pouviez utiliser pour exécuter des commandes réseau telles que ping.

Cependant, les dernières versions ont déprécié cet utilitaire au profit de Terminal . Ce n'est pas aussi intuitif à utiliser, mais c'est quand même assez simple. Tout(First) d'abord , ouvrez Terminal en ouvrant Spotlight ( Commande(Command) + Barre(Spacebar) d'espace ) et en tapant terminal .

Pour lancer un ping, il suffit de taper la commande telle qu'elle était affichée dans Windows : ping suivi de l'adresse IP ou de l' URL du site Web, c'est-à-dire ping www.google.com .

La principale différence que vous remarquerez entre l'utilisation de ping sur Windows et Mac est que sur macOS, il continue jusqu'à ce que vous l'arrêtiez manuellement. Pour arrêter le ping du périphérique ou de l' URL , appuyez sur Ctrl + C . Cela vous ramènera à l'invite principale.

Pour voir une liste de tous les paramètres que vous pouvez utiliser pour le ping sur macOS, vous pouvez taper man ping et obtenir les pages d'aide. Il y a beaucoup de commutateurs, alors prenez votre temps pour jouer avec les différentes options.

Pour sortir de la page de manuel, vous devez simplement appuyer sur la touche q de votre clavier. Cela quittera la page de manuel et vous ramènera à l'invite.

La commande ping est très polyvalente et constitue souvent le moyen le plus rapide de déterminer où se situe le problème sur un réseau. Nous vous recommandons vivement de consulter Les meilleures commandes réseau de la ligne de commande Windows(The Best Windows Command Line Network Commands) pour les commandes de diagnostic réseau essentielles.



About the author

Je suis un ingénieur en matériel avec plus de 10 ans d'expérience dans le domaine. Je me spécialise dans les contrôleurs et les câbles USB, ainsi que dans les mises à niveau du BIOS et le support ACPI. Dans mes temps libres, j'aime aussi bloguer sur divers sujets liés à la technologie et à l'ingénierie.



Related posts